Why choose Huawei hyper converged?
With the deepening development of the digital economy, many enterprises are gradually shifting their focus to innovative and agile businesses. The difference in business volume between the initial and peak periods of maturity is significant, and IT infrastructure is often difficult to achieve in one step. Lightweight start-up and agile flexibility have become key requirements for innovative enterprises to deploy IT infrastructure.
More and more data is being generated in branches. Due to the complex environment, unique geographical location, and strong industry attributes of enterprise branches, wide adaptability to the environment and minimalist management have become key demands for deploying data centers in enterprise branches.
The proposal of the national "dual carbon" strategy drives the further development of enterprise IT infrastructure towards intensification and green energy conservation. Hyper converged infrastructure is increasingly becoming an important choice for enterprises to deploy data centers due to its agility, flexibility, resource efficiency, and minimalist management.
Four major advantages to assist enterprises in digital transformation
Huawei has launched a series of hyper converged infrastructure (HCI) products for data centers, which enable on-demand loading of management, backup, disaster recovery, and other functions through software definition on the basis of computing, storage, and network integration, and can achieve integrated delivery through pre integration. By installing intelligent management software and matching intelligent algorithms for various industry scenarios, we achieve full scene coverage from data centers to enterprise branches, with the characteristics of flexible architecture, powerful performance, secure and reliable, and simple and efficient.
Flexible architecture
• Component Separable Architecture (CDI): Supports independent expansion of computing and storage, planning free, and linear expansion as needed
• Intelligent QoS: Pooling of storage computing power resources and flexible allocation of resources on demand
• X86/Kunpeng Dual Ecological System
• Multi cloud collaboration: achieving seamless integration with the cloud
Powerful performance
•With the support of SmartDPU, CPU computing power is released, resulting in a 20% increase in computing power density. A single node can achieve 120000 IOPS
•High proportion EC, with a maximum ratio of 22+2, can achieve a capacity ratio of up to 91%
•15 minute high-speed reconstruction, leading the industry
Safe and reliable
•Cross cluster true AA dual active, synchronous replication
• Full stack dual active capability including virtualization true dual active
• Self developed lightweight safety container
•Intelligent health check and advance prediction of faults
Simple and efficient
• All in 1 high integration 5U miniaturized dedicated hardware
• Delete compression+data reduction, reducing the threshold for full flash
•20000+site full stack one-stop management, one click operation and maintenance, no need for professional IT on duty in branch scenarios
• High throughput data storage network bus direct connection
